What is a Controls Engineer Project Manager?

A Controls Engineer Project Manager is a professional who oversees the design, implementation, and management of automation and control systems within projects. They combine technical expertise in controls engineering—such as programming PLCs, designing control panels, and integrating industrial systems—with project management skills like budgeting, scheduling, and team coordination. Their role ensures that automation projects are completed safely, on time, and within budget, while meeting all technical and quality standards. They often act as the main point of contact between clients, engineers, and other stakeholders.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Controls Engineer Project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Controls Engineer Project Manager, you need a strong background in electrical engineering, automation systems, and project management, typically supported by a relevant engineering degree and PMP certification. Familiarity with PLC programming, SCADA systems, AutoCAD, and project management software such as MS Project is commonly required. Excellent leadership, problem-solving, and communication skills help drive teams, manage stakeholders, and ensure project delivery. These skills and qualifications are vital for overseeing complex automation projects, maintaining technical standards, and achieving project goals on time and within budget.

How does a Controls Engineer Project Manager typically collaborate with cross-functional teams during project execution?

A Controls Engineer Project Manager frequently works alongside electrical engineers, software developers, mechanical engineers, and project stakeholders to ensure that control systems meet project requirements and deadlines. Collaboration often involves organizing regular meetings, facilitating clear communication of technical specifications, and addressing integration challenges between different system components. Strong teamwork and leadership skills are essential, as the Project Manager must coordinate tasks, resolve conflicts, and ensure all team members are aligned toward project goals. This collaborative environment fosters innovation and helps maintain project timelines and quality standards.

Job Description:
The Controls Engineer III is responsible for leading all phases of a controls project to include concept and research, estimating support, component selection, network design, panel design, layout, device troubleshooting, PLC and HMI programming; on-site installation and debug; and after-sales support while working independently. A successful Controls Engineer III has an expert level of knowledge and understanding of the full scope of controls engineering practices, theories, and PLC programming to implement the controls for a project from concept to completion. The Controls Engineer III serves as a subject matter expert and resource for their team and provides coaching and guidance while working at a job site or in-office collaboration. To keep their knowledge up-to-date, the Controls Engineer III will attend training in the latest controls technology and have the ability to share that knowledge with less experienced controls engineers as well as work collaboratively with the Engineering Manager to provide insight on the latest advancements in the field of controls engineering to implement new standards for the company.
Expert understanding of AC/DC control systems.
Use of computer software for design engineering and PLC programing.
Capable of trouble shooting a system and communicate status - verbally and written.
Assist and support the process for designing and delivering successful control.
Designing and developing layouts for electrical circuits or systems for power and control distribution.
Develop/create electrical diagrams with expert level of efficiency.
Ability to locate and correct mistakes in electrical diagrams developed by others on the team and use this information as a training opportunity for others to foster the continuous improvement of their skills. (Transfer of knowledge)
Be the controls lead and manage other engineers on project teams.
Capable of creating functional system test plans for use in field commissioning and provide written descriptions of system operations for technical documents.
